Basic Concepts of Plain Hose Couplings
Plain hose couplings are devices used to join two hoses or a hose to a rigid pipe in fluid transfer systems. They operate by compressing the hose between two flanges, creating a seal that prevents leaks. These couplings are commonly employed in various industries for their simplicity and effectiveness in connecting hoses without the need for additional clamps or fasteners 1.

Cummins Engine Compatibility with Part 5266153
The Plain Hose Coupling part 5266153, manufactured by Cummins, is designed to fit seamlessly with a variety of Cummins engines. This part is integral for maintaining the integrity of the engine’s cooling and exhaust systems, ensuring optimal performance and reliability.
QSB6.7 Series
- QSB6.7 CM2250
- QSB6.7 CM2350 B105
The QSB6.7 series engines, including the CM2250 and CM2350 B105 variants, are known for their robust performance and versatility. The Plain Hose Coupling part 5266153 is specifically engineered to fit these engines, providing a secure connection for hoses that are critical for the engine’s operation.
QSC9 and QSL9 Series
- QSC9 CM2250/QSL9 CM2250
- QSL9 CM2250
- QSL9 CM2350 L102
The QSC9 and QSL9 series engines, particularly the CM2250 and CM2350 L102 variants, benefit from the Plain Hose Coupling part 5266153. This part ensures that the hoses remain firmly attached, preventing leaks and maintaining the necessary pressure for efficient engine operation. The compatibility of this part across these models underscores its importance in the overall maintenance and functionality of these engines.
Role of Part 5266153 Plain Hose Coupling in Engine Systems
In the context of engine systems, the Part 5266153 Plain Hose Coupling is instrumental in ensuring the seamless operation of various components.
Turbocharger Cool Drain / Vent Tube
The turbocharger cool drain / vent tube is designed to manage the release of excess pressure and fluids from the turbocharger. The Plain Hose Coupling facilitates a secure and leak-proof connection between the turbocharger and the drain/vent tube. This ensures that any coolant or other fluids are efficiently directed away from the turbocharger, maintaining optimal performance and preventing potential damage from pressure build-up.
Vent
In engine systems, vents are essential for releasing pressure and gases that could otherwise cause harm if retained within the system. The Plain Hose Coupling plays a significant role in connecting the vent to other components, ensuring that the vent operates effectively. This connection helps in maintaining a balanced pressure environment within the engine, which is vital for consistent and reliable performance.
Engine Coolant
Engine coolant is a vital fluid that regulates the temperature of the engine, preventing it from overheating. The Plain Hose Coupling is used to connect various sections of the coolant system, including hoses and radiator components. This ensures that the coolant flows smoothly and without interruption, which is essential for maintaining the engine’s temperature within safe operating limits. The secure connection provided by the coupling helps prevent leaks, which could lead to engine damage due to overheating.
